The Scott Archery Legacy Release is a unisex, ambidextrous archery release aid featuring an auto-closing, ergonomic HyperJawsCompact design for consistent anchor points. It incorporates Scott’s reliable caliper Roller Sear mechanism and an infinitely adjustable NCS connector strap with premium leather and neoprene materials, delivering durability, comfort, and precision for serious archers.

Solid adjustable trigger
I was on the market for a release that would reliably handle the weight I was pulling. Heard too many horror stories of people knocking out their own teeth. The construction is solid with thick metal teeth that'll aide in controlling whatever weight you're pulling. The wrist strap is adjustable for the biggest of hands, I wear large gloves and I have my wrist strap set to the 2nd lowest hole. You can also adjust the overall distance the release protrudes from the wrist and I find that it's extremely comfortable to shoot even in those sessions where you've been shooting for hours. The trigger is light with no wall, helps you learn how to not jerk the trigger but be careful to not have your finger on the trigger while you draw. For how affordable this release is, this is one of the best performing ones out there for the price
